Remote Staff Software Engineer, Fullstack (Onchain Payments)

Posted

Apply now
Please, let Coinbase Developer Platform know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Coinbase Developer Platform (CDP) is focused on building developer tools to facilitate onchain development.
  • The team aims to create an easy-to-use and trusted developer experience to bring a million developers onchain.
  • The role is for the lead engineer of the Onchain Payments effort, which involves both new product development and enhancements to the existing Coinbase Commerce product.
  • Responsibilities include bringing a 0-to-1 product to life to replace the global payment stack with crypto rails.
  • The engineer will lead the fullstack design and development of a secure, high-performance product using TypeScript, Go, and Solidity.
  • Rapid prototyping of user flows to gain market feedback and productionizing code as necessary is expected.
  • Integration with existing Coinbase surfaces, including Smart Wallet, Commerce, and Platform APIs, is required.
  • The role involves designing, implementing, and driving adoption of a novel open-source web3 payment protocol using Solidity.
  • Collaboration with product managers, designers, and cross-functional partners to find product market fit is essential.
  • The engineer will maintain and improve upon an existing legacy codebase of Coinbase Commerce.
  • Driving the adoption of engineering best practices and ensuring operational excellence is a key responsibility.
  • Performance optimization of frontend and backend systems for fast transaction processing and smooth UI interactions is necessary.
  • Troubleshooting and debugging complex fullstack issues to ensure platform stability, reliability, and security is required.
  • Providing technical guidance and support to the engineering team and contributing to the overall technical direction of Coinbase is expected.

Requirements:

  • Candidates must have 8+ years of experience in software development with a strong focus on fullstack development; 2+ years in a leadership position at a crypto start-up is a plus.
  • Mastery of Go, JavaScript, TypeScript, and Solidity is required; familiarity with Ruby is a plus.
  • A proven track record of rapidly shipping high-quality fullstack systems is necessary.
  • Candidates should have a deep understanding of Ethereum and EVM-compatible chains, along with experience in developing smart contracts.
  • A demonstrated commitment to excellent developer experiences and open source code, particularly in relation to crypto and payments, is essential.
  • Strong expertise in frontend development using modern frameworks like React, Next.js, and Angular is required.
  • A solid understanding of distributed systems, microservices architecture, and event-driven architectures is necessary, including experience with databases (PostgreSQL, MySQL, MongoDB), caching systems (Redis, Memcached), and message queues (Kafka, RabbitMQ).
  • Experience with developer operations, including cloud providers such as AWS and containerization technologies like Kubernetes, is required.
  • A deep understanding of web security best practices and experience implementing secure coding practices for financial systems is essential.
  • Exceptional problem-solving skills and the ability to find elegant solutions to complex challenges in the crypto payment processing domain are necessary.
  • Outstanding communication, leadership, and collaboration skills, with the ability to inspire and mentor teams, are required.
  • A Bachelor's or Master's degree in Computer Science, Software Engineering, or equivalent experience is necessary.

Benefits:

  • The target annual salary for this position ranges from $211,650 to $249,000 USD, depending on work location.
  • Full-time offers from Coinbase include a target bonus, target equity, and benefits such as medical, dental, vision, and 401(k).
  • Coinbase is committed to diversity in its workforce and is an Equal Opportunity Employer, ensuring all qualified applicants receive consideration for employment without discrimination.
  • Reasonable accommodations for individuals with disabilities are provided during the employment process.
Apply now
Please, let Coinbase Developer Platform know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
$ 211,650 - 249,000 USD / year
CD
Coinbase Developer Platform's company logo
Coinbase Developer Platform
View company profile
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back